I usually bring a box of wine that is the equivalent of 4 bottles of wine on our cruises. We have always gone out of Miami, and I've never had a problem. How strict is Jacksonville on the carry on alcohol policy? I'd rather bring two bottles and have them versus attempting four and having nothing.

It's the cruise lines decision not the Ports. If the cruise line is strict the port will be to.

Not sure about Jacksonville, but I do know that in every other port of departure, they are. Even down to taking a single 1.5 liter of boxed wine that is the same as 2 bottles. The Carnival rule is 1 bottle per adult passenger. We've gotten 3-4 bottles in a single carryon bag on board in the past but we were traveling with In-Laws and they were right with us in security.
